xDSL Setup
NETGEAR recommends that you use the Setup Wizard to detect the DSL connection and
automatically set up the modem router (see Internet Connection Setup Wizard on page 41).
If you have technical experience and are sure of the correct DSL mode, multiplexing method,
and virtual circuit number for the virtual path identifier (VPI) and virtual channel identifier
(VCI), you can specify those settings on the xDSL Setup screen. NETGEAR recommends
that you enter the multiplexing method, VPI, and VCI only if your ISP provided you this
information.
To view or change the DSL setup:
1. Select BASIC > xDSL Setup.
The selection from the Physical WAN Type menu is fixed at ADSL2+.
2. From the DSL Mode menu, select the DSL mode that your ISP provided you:
Auto. The modem router detects the DSL mode automatically. This is the default
setting.
ADSL (g.dmt).
ADSL2.
ADSL2+.
3. Click the upper Apply button.
The DSL mode is saved.
4. From the Multiplexing Method menu, select LLC-based or VC-based, as indicated by your
ISP.
5. For the VPI, type a number between 0 and 255, as indicated by your ISP.
The default setting is 0.
6. For the VCI, type a number between 32 and 65535, as indicated by your ISP.
The default setting is 38.
7. Click the lower Apply button.
The PVC settings are saved.
